Atlanta Braves Holdings (BATRA) Revenue (2022 - 2026)
Atlanta Braves Holdings filings provide 5 years of Revenue readings, the most recent being $72.0 million for Q1 2026.
- On a quarterly basis, Revenue rose 52.52% to $72.0 million in Q1 2026 year-over-year; TTM through Mar 2026 was $757.3 million, a 12.54% increase, with the full-year FY2025 number at $732.5 million, up 10.52% from a year prior.
- Revenue hit $72.0 million in Q1 2026 for Atlanta Braves Holdings, up from $61.3 million in the prior quarter.
